Bhubaneswar: Vedanta Aluminium, India’s largest aluminium producer, is extending healthcare support to women and families in remote regions through the Government of India’s Swasth Nari Sashakt Parivar Abhiyaan.

Launched by Prime Minister Narendra Modi, this initiative is the nation’s largest health outreach for women and children, jointly led by the Ministry of Health & Family Welfare and the Ministry of Women & Child Development. Between September 17 and October 2, more than 10 lakh health camps are being conducted across Ayushman Arogya Mandirs, Community Health Centres (CHC), Primary Health Centres (PHC), District Hospitals, and other government facilities.

As part of the campaign, Vedanta Aluminium organised health camps at the PHC in Nakrundi, Kalahandi and CHC in Kashipur, Rayagada, deploying its Mobile Health Units (MHUs) along with medical staff, diagnostics, and essential medicines. The camps benefitted 468 women and more than 410 men and children.  Building on this outreach, the company will also support upcoming camps at Rampur and Sunger.
